As many of you may know, we had a poll on our forums asking for everyone's feedback (thank you!) on a weapon degradation and repair system. As a result of that poll, we've started to implement a gun jamming system into the game now. In addition to the gun jamming, we've also discussed adding other issues to the game for weapons that haven't been taken care of or repaired - issues such as reduced damage, reduced range, greater bullet spread, and many more. We hope to have several of those ready for the alpha testing phase as well, so we can collect your feedback on what you like or dislike. As long as a player takes care of their weapons, none of these issues will affect them - it's just for those who choose to neglect their weapons.
